Author: Ivan March
This is one of those CDs which demonstrates only too well that if the microphone placing, within a chosen acoustic, is ill-judged the results will be aurally unattractive. Throughout 1812 and in the very loud climax of Bolero, the upper range is shrill and the strings sound glassy. I found myself wincing. The brilliance is entirely aritificial, and the recording also demonstrates how unflattering is the hall which the engineers had chosen. Les preludes is much better, but the climax still sounds brash. The piece suits Muti well and is the best thing here. Bolero is taken slowly and the expressive sentience in the opening section seems overdone; 1812 is fiercely exciting, but everything is on the surface, there is no communicated warmth or sense of geniality and although the closing impact is very considerable, cannon and all, one is not really involved in the music itself.'
